What is Heavy Truck Tire Inflator?

A heavy truck tire inflator is a specialized device designed to add air to large truck tires. It typically features a robust air compressor, a pressure gauge for accurate monitoring, and a long, durable hose with a secure chuck for connecting to valve stems. These inflators are crucial for maintaining proper tire pressure in commercial vehicles, which is vital for fuel efficiency, vehicle safety, and extended tire lifespan. They ensure optimal load bearing capacity and prevent premature tire wear, directly contributing to operational cost savings and safer transportation of goods.

How do various tire inflator types and inflation technologies address the heavy truck market's demands?

The market accommodates diverse needs through types such as portable inflators for on the go repairs, stationary systems for large fleet depots, and digital inflators offering precise pressure readings. Similarly, inflation technologies range from basic manual inflation to advanced automatic inflation and smart inflation systems. Automatic and smart systems are gaining traction among heavy truck operators for their ability to ensure consistent, accurate pressure maintenance with minimal human intervention, enhancing efficiency and reducing errors across large fleets.

What impact do power sources and advanced inflation technologies have on heavy truck tire inflator adoption?

The choice of power source electric, battery operated, or pneumatic significantly influences inflator deployment, with battery operated units offering flexibility for roadside or remote applications, while electric and pneumatic options are common in fixed workshops. When combined with automatic or smart inflation systems, these power sources enable sophisticated tire management. Smart inflation systems, for instance, can integrate with fleet management software, providing real time data and predictive maintenance insights, which are invaluable for optimizing the performance and safety of heavy truck fleets.

What Regulatory and Policy Factors Shape the Global Heavy Truck Tire Inflator Market

The global heavy truck tire inflator market operates within a dynamic regulatory landscape prioritizing safety, efficiency, and environmental compliance. Agencies like the US DOT, FMCSA, and European ECE establish rigorous standards for inflator design, pressure accuracy, and operational reliability. These mandates often necessitate features like automatic shutoff and precise calibration. Increasingly, regulations promoting fleet fuel efficiency and emissions reduction indirectly boost inflator adoption, as correctly inflated tires minimize rolling resistance. Workplace safety regulations also influence product design and usage protocols. Emerging policies regarding vehicle connectivity and autonomous systems suggest future integration opportunities, further driving demand for advanced, compliant tire inflation solutions worldwide.
